On Wed, Jan 17, 2007 at 12:24:55PM +0100, Stephane Bortzmeyer wrote:
> PowerDNS (Subversion version of today, r949) cannot compile:
>
> checking for MySQL library directory... configure: error: Didn't find the mysql library dir in '/usr/local/mysql/lib/mysql /usr/local/lib/mysql /opt/mysql/lib/mysql /usr/lib/mysql /usr/local/mysql/lib /usr/local/lib /opt/mysql/lib /usr/lib /usr/sfw/lib/'
Try --with-modules=""
The --with-mysql and --without-mysql stuff should be removed, they are a
very old leftover. I'll remove it.
